The WC2XSR/13 transmitter went back on the air at 1500 CDT Saturday
afternoon.

The control power fuse blew out when I turned the transmitter on to warm
up. I had to open the case to change the fuse. (Poor design!) The
transmitter webcam is back on line as well.

The ARGO receiver webcam is still down, because the HP-3586B has decided
to go deaf for signals, although it hears thunderstorms just fine. (It
figures!)

Transmitter power output is 400 watts on 166.500 KC.

The modulation sequence is: The ID letters "XSR" are sent once in QRSS30
mode, then the following plain text is sent three times in 10 WPM CW,
"DE WC2XSR/13 DE WC2XSR/13 QSL VIA W5JGV". The modulation sequence then
repeats.
